  • Patent number: 5372528
    Abstract: Tilt and trim cylinders have blind-end chambers connected through a main valve to a first port of a reversible pump. The rod-end chamber of the tilt cylinder is connected through the main valve to a second port of the reversible pump. The rod-end chamber of the trim cylinder is connected to an oil tank. The second port of the pump is connected to the oil tank, and the first port may be connected to either only the main valve or the oil tank through a suction-prevention valve, an orifice, or a pressure relief valve. When the pump is actuated with the tilt cylinder locked to keep an outboard engine in an tilted-up position, the trim cylinder is automatically contracted to withdraw its piston rod. Cavitation in an oil passage from the blind-end chamber of the trim cylinder to the pump is prevented when working oil is introduced from the oil tank to the pump through the orifice or the pressure relief valve.
